How to clip overlapping paths?

Participant ,
Jan 10, 2026 Jan 10, 2026

At the bottom of this escutcheon, I tried to join two paths.   They ended up overlapping each other.  How do I cut off those little pieces? (They are at the pointy end of the sheild) I tried a clipping mask, but that did not work.  Should I just go back and redraw it?  Of course I didn't notice it until I went to turn it into a pdf!

You can use the Shape Builder Tool (Shift+M) and hold down the Alt key when clicking the intersection.
